Telling Your Family's Story and Creating Family History Videos Don't just gather genealogical information. Take the time to tell your ancestors' stories! Video is the perfect medium for sharing your family's history. It captures the interest of the eyes and the ears. In this episode my special guest is Kathy Nielsen. She's a librarian from California who recently started creating videos. She's going to walk you through the simple yet effective process she followed. Then I will share additional things to consider and strategies that you can use. If you're not interested in creating a video, that's OK. Today's episode will make you a better storyteller and will provide you with inspiring story examples by other genealogists. Watch the companion video and read the full show notes here. March 2020 Click here for the complete show notes. In this episode we're going to delve into how DNA testing and genetic genealogy has changed our world. Award-winning journalist Libby Copeland, author of the new book The Lost Family: How DNA Testing is Upending Who We Are discusses genetic genealogy, the big DNA testing companies (AncestryDNA, 23andMe, Family Tree DNA, and MyHeritageDNA) The Golden State Killer Case and the use of genetic genealogy DNA for criminal investigation, the genealogy community and RootsTech, adoption and NPE cases, and more. February 2020 I LOVE genealogy, mysteries and puzzle solving. Are you with me on that? Well in this episode we have not one by two tales of mystery. The first has a Valentine's theme centered around a mysterious love letter. Professional genealogist Kathleen Ackerman will be here to share how a love letter that was missing its last page took her on a genealogical journey full of surprises. And our second story is a mystery full of twists, turns and murder that will ultimately resurrect your faith that what you think is lost, may still be found. Click here for the complete show notes.

In this episode I have two interviews for you on very different subjects. First up will be a follow up to last month's episode where we focused specifically on the New York Public Library Photographers' Identities Catalog. Well, in this episode we're going to talk to the genealogy reference librarian at the New York Public Library, Andy McCarthy. And as you'll hear, there are a massive amount of resource available there for genealogists everywhere. Then we'll switch gears to Scandinavian genealogy with David Fryxell, author of the new book The Family Tree Scandinavian Genealogy Guide: How to Trace Your Ancestors in Denmark, Sweden and Norway. Hosted by Lisa Louise Cooke Recorded December 2019 My how time flies and it's flying further and further way from when our ancestors' got their photographs taken, which can make the task of identifying and dating them harder and harder. Do not fret my friend because I have the coolest free tech tool for you that can help you zero in on the date of your photos. David Lowe a Specialist in the Photography Collection of the New York Public Library will be joining me today to tell you all about it. And, we're going to be talking about some important genealogical records that you may be missing at Ancestry.com. I wrote about How to Find and Browse Unindexed Records at Ancestry in the Genealogy Gems newsletter which linked over to my article on our website, but this is so important that we need to talk about here together.
